""Notes on Rubber Cultivation: With Special Reference to Portuguese India"" is a book written by John Alfred Wyllie and published in 1907. The book is a comprehensive guide to rubber cultivation, with a particular focus on the rubber plantations of Portuguese India (modern-day Goa). The book covers a wide range of topics related to rubber cultivation, including the history of rubber cultivation, the different varieties of rubber plants, the various methods of tapping and collecting rubber, and the processing of rubber. Wyllie also provides detailed information on the tools and equipment used in rubber cultivation, as well as the labor practices and management strategies employed on rubber plantations.Throughout the book, Wyllie draws on his own extensive experience as a rubber planter and manager, as well as the knowledge and expertise of other experts in the field. The book is richly illustrated with photographs and diagrams, making it a valuable resource for anyone interested in rubber cultivation, whether as a professional rubber planter or as a hobbyist.Overall, ""Notes on Rubber Cultivation: With Special Reference to Portuguese India"" is a comprehensive and authoritative guide to rubber cultivation, written by an expert in the field. It is an important historical document that provides valuable insights into the practices and techniques of rubber cultivation in the early 20th century.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
